    DEPARTMENT OF ENERGY
    [Docket No. ER95-62-000]
    
    
    TexPar Energy, Inc.; Notice of Issuance of Order
    
    January 13, 1995.
        On October 24, 1994 and November 10, 1994, TexPar Energy, Inc. 
    (TexPar) submitted for filing a rate schedule under which TexPar will 
    engage in wholesale electric power and energy transactions as a 
    marketer. TexPar also requested waiver of various Commission 
    regulations. In particular, TexPar requested that the Commission grant 
    blanket approval under 18 CFR Part 34 of all future issuances of 
    securities and assumptions of liability by TexPar.
        On December 27, 1994, pursuant to delegated authority, the 
    Director, Division of Applications, Office of Electric Power 
    Regulation, granted requests for blanket approval under Part 34, 
    subject to the following:
        Within thirty days of the date of the order, any person desiring to 
    be heard or to protest the blanket approval of issuances of securities 
    or assumptions of liability by TexPar should file a motion to intervene 
    or protest with the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ission, 825 North 
    Capitol Street, NE., Washington, DC 20426, in accordance with Rules 211 
    and 214 of the Commission's Rules of Practice and Procedure (18 CFR 
    385.211 and 385.214).
        Absent a request for hearing within this period, TexPar is 
    authorized to issue securities and assume obligations or liabilities as 
    a guarantor, indorser, surety, or otherwise in respect of any security 
    of another person; provided that such issuance or assumption is for 
    some lawful object within the corporate purposes of the applicant, and 
    compatible with the public interest, and is reasonably necessary or 
    appropriate for such purposes.
        The Commission reserves the right to require a further showing that 
    neither public nor private interests will be adversely affected by 
    continued approval of TexPar's issuances of securities or assumptions 
    of liability.
        Notice is hereby given that the deadline for filing motions to 
    intervene or protests, as set forth above, is January 26, 1995.
        Copies of the full text of the order are available from the 
    Commission's Public Reference Branch, Room 3308, 941 North Capitol 
    Street, NE., Washington, DC 20426.
